Abstract :
This letter investigates the joint estimation of the direction of departure (DOD) and direction of arrival (DOA) for multi-input multi-output (MIMO) radar systems. A novel estimation method based on non-uniform array configuration is proposed and the practical identifiability of the corresponding parameter is analyzed. The key idea is to use the Doppler diversity to construct a virtual MIMO array. Through the theoretical proof, we demonstrate that the proposed method can provide much stronger parameter identifiability than the conventional ones, and also can improve the parameter estimation performance. Numerical simulations verify the effectiveness of the proposed algorithm.
